Family System Therapy
A form of psychotherapy that views problems within the family in the context of the family unit rather than on individual members.
Biopsychosocial
An interdisciplinary model that looks at the interconnection between biology, psychology, and socio-environmental factors.
Abnormal Behavior
Actions or behaviors that are atypical or deviate significantly from societal norms or expectations.
DSM-IV
The fourth edition of the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, a classification system for mental disorders used by mental health professionals.
